About Tap Water in ZIP Code 90607
Tap water in ZIP code 90607 (Whittier, CA) meets all federal safety standards and earns a solid B grade (score: 83/100). Served by Whittier-city, Water Department, the water system has maintained general compliance with EPA Safe Drinking Water Act regulations, with only minor issues on record.

Water Source & Environmental Factors
Ground Water
This system draws water from underground aquifers. Groundwater is naturally filtered through soil and rock, but can still contain naturally occurring minerals like arsenic, radium, or nitrates.

Data Sources & Methodology
Water quality data for ZIP code 90607 is compiled from the EPA Safe Drinking Water Information System (SDWIS), EPA ECHO enforcement database, UCMR5 unregulated contaminant monitoring, and Consumer Confidence Reports filed by Whittier-city, Water Department. Safety scores are composite metrics derived from violation history, lead levels, enforcement actions, and infrastructure risk indicators. Data reflects a 5-year monitoring window.
